Transaction 66a85c27e69517b3e9305a2756bba683467fe0f3d51cae2f0110e99ec73b1f29
1 Input
1 Output
-
66a85c27e69517b3e9305a2756bba683467fe0f3d51cae2f0110e99ec73b1f29:0
- value
- 95768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bbd83a81cbf81498a484526dc2878318ffe6b2e OP_EQUAL
- address
- 34DhCQXcVtLJAV9ecLhxQro8a7fQAyTtii